Вопросы

Елена Лобынцева
Как научить НС распознавать внутреннюю область многоугольника, например с координатами А(-1,-1),В(0,4),С(5,1),Д(4,-2),Е(1,-3)
Помогите разобраться как можно подобрать НС для распознавания внутренней области выпуклого многоугольника?
Олег Семенов
Олег Семенов 20 сентября 2013 в 14:46

Если представить выпуклый многоугольник как набор прямых на плоскости, и каждой из плоскостей поставить в соответствие нейрон внутреннего слоя, а потом собрать информацию с этих нейронов в единый выходной нейрон, получим в результате ответ. Веса нейронов внутреннего слоя необходимо настроить таким образом, чтобы при получении координаты с одной стороны соответствующей прямой они получали возбуждение (1), а с другой - торможение (0).

Олег Семенов
Олег Семенов 20 сентября 2013 в 14:49

Причем возбуждение нейроны должны получать с той стороны прямой, где находится большинство точек многоугольника.